Coral Goes Swimming by Simon Puttock
Lying in her paddling pool, Coral lets her imagination take her round the world's oceans, hopping off at different continents and playing with the seas' creatures. A lyrical text and stunning illustrations combine to make a truly beautiful picture book, which will open children's eyes to the world beyond their environs. THE AUTHOR - Simon Puttock travelled extensively as a child, growing up in places as diverse as Barbados and Kent! He studied English at Newcastle University and is now an established figure in the children's bookselling world, working for Waterstones, Newcastle. This is his first picture book. WHEREABOUTS - Newcastle BIRTHPLACE - New Zealand PREVIOUS BOOKS - Same Difference, Anthology of Teenage Stories, Egmont
Lesley Agnew is very taken with the beautiful artwork by Stephen Lambert* The Children's Bookseller (March 2000) *
THE ILLUSTRATOR - Stephen Lambert is a well-known illustrator, who has worked with many major children's authors. He attended Lincoln College of Art. He now lives in Cornwall.
